What services does the Social Services program provide?

Do you have a question about what programs are available for you in the community, how to pursue citizenship, or do you need help with reading a letter or bill? Social Services can help. We work in three main areas:

General Information and Referral

  • Sometimes you may just need some information and are not sure who to ask for that information. We can make the call for you, look something up on the internet, or direct you to the appropriate office, agency, or organization for more information.
  • Sometimes you may need assistance with reading notices you’ve received in the mail or letters that are written in English.
  • We frequently assist with filling out applications. Typically these applications are for Unemployment Insurance, State Disability Insurance, Medi-Cal, General Assistance, Food Stamps, SSI, CalWORKs, In-Home Supportive Services (IHSS), Senior Housing, etc.
  • We can also refer you to programs that you may be eligible for like energy assistance programs for low-income families (such as: HEAP and CARE) and paratransit services.

Citizenship Services
Are you planning to apply for citizenship?

  • We can help you with your citizenship questions regarding eligibility, the process, and timing.
  • We can help you fill out your naturalization application.
  • We run citizenship classes and offer individual preparation for naturalization interviews.

Notary Public Service
Do you have a document you need notarized?

Some examples of frequently notarized documents include Survival Certificates, Power of Attorney, deeds and contracts.

Other Services

  •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A).
  • Off-site presentations or workshops on topical subjects like Medicare Part D.
